Residential Roof Replacement in Boston, MA
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new roofing system to protect the home from weather elements and ensure structural integrity. These projects typically cover various roofing materials, including as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and other durable options, and are often requested when a roof has sustained significant damage, shows signs of aging, or no longer provides adequate protection.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the replacement, the materials used, and how the new roof will improve the home's durability and appearance before proceeding with a project.
Property owners considering roof replacement should evaluate the condition of their current roofing system, including signs of leaks, missing shingles, or extensive wear. It’s also helpful to understand the expected lifespan of different roofing materials and how the replacement process might impact the property. Clarifying the scope of work, including removal, disposal, and installation processes, can ensure that homeowners are prepared for the project and can make informed decisions about their roofing needs.

Residential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s that a ro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ing shingles, widespread leaks, or aged materials indicate the need for a roof replacement.
What types of roofing materials are available for replacement?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and architectural styles suited for residential properties.
How does a roof replacement impact property value? A new roof can enhance curb appeal and may increase overall property value for homeowners and property owners.
What should property owners consider before scheduling a roof replacement? It's important to assess the roof's condition, choose suitable materials, and ensure proper installation to protect the home.
